Transaction 69134863e301558752d55d8d6cd2a73851216b6d96d5746d3349cdc767b0eee3

1 Input
2 Outputs
  • 69134863e301558752d55d8d6cd2a73851216b6d96d5746d3349cdc767b0eee3:0
  • value  19980000
    address  18seA2EiDKK85vbkSgkAcCWT2BThfCGupP
  • 69134863e301558752d55d8d6cd2a73851216b6d96d5746d3349cdc767b0eee3:1
  • value  2515590172
    address  35Fhdn4fjBpD7tje8ehvJ3KzUFRH1sMgM6